What is the B1 English Exam?
The B1 exam represents the "Intermediate" level on the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). For the purposes of Indefinite Leave to Remain (ILR) and British Citizenship, the Home Office requires evidence that a candidate can interact successfully in English.
At the B1 level, a prospect is anticipated to understand the main points of clear standard input on familiar matters regularly encountered in work, school, and leisure. Most importantly, for most immigration paths, only the Speaking and Listening parts are evaluated, rather than reading and writing.
Primary Costs: A Comparison of Test Providers
The Home Office only accepts B1 certificates from specific, government-approved suppliers. These are referred to as Secure English Language Test (SELT) suppliers. As of 2024, the 4 main suppliers in the UK are Trinity College London, IELTS SELT Consortium, Pearson (PTE), and LanguageCert.
While the rates are reasonably competitive, they differ slightly based upon the company and the particular area of the test center.
Table 1: Standard B1 Exam Fees by ProviderTest ProviderTest NameApproximate CostFormatTrinity College LondonGESE Grade 5₤ 150 - ₤ 15510-minute 1-to-1 discussionIELTS SELT ConsortiumIELTS Life Skills - B1₤ 155 - ₤ 16022-minute group session (2 candidates)Pearson (PTE)PTE Home Zertifikat B1 Telc₤ 150 - ₤ 170Computer-based (speaking/listening)LanguageCertInternational ESOL SELT B1₤ 130 - ₤ 14515-minute 1-to-1 conversation
Keep in mind: Prices undergo change and might vary based on VAT and local surcharges.
In-depth Breakdown of Test Formats
The "cost" of an examination is not just monetary; it is likewise identified by the time and effort required to get ready for a particular format. Some candidates discover specific formats easier, which may lower the possibility of requiring a costly retake.
1. Trinity College London (GESE Grade 5)
This is extensively thought about the most popular choice for citizenship applicants. It is a 10-minute speaking and listening exam with an inspector. Prospects prepare a "subject kind" in advance to discuss, which provides a sense of control over the exam content.
2. IELTS Life Skills - B1
Conducted by the British Council or IDP, this examination includes 2 prospects and one inspector. The prospects must interact with each other in addition to the examiner. This format might be difficult for those who do not like group assessments, but it is highly recognized internationally.
3. Pearson (PTE Home B1)
Unlike the others, Pearson is totally computer-based. Prospects speak into a microphone and listen to triggers through a headset. The outcomes are typically processed considerably quicker, often within 24 hours, which can be advantageous for those on tight deadlines.
4. LanguageCert
LanguageCert provides a flexible technique with lots of test centers. Like Trinity, it is a one-to-one interview format. It is often the most competitively priced option in the UK market.
Secondary and Hidden Costs
The headline price of the exam is rarely the final amount an applicant invests. A number of secondary factors can inflate the total budget plan.
Preparation Materials and Courses
While lots of candidates with a great grasp of English pick to self-study, others go with official preparation.

Does the B1 exam charge include the expense of the citizenship application?
No. The B1 exam charge is paid exclusively to the test supplier. The Home Office application cost for citizenship or ILR is a different, much bigger expense (currently going beyond ₤ 1,500 for a lot of applicants).
2. What takes place if a prospect fails the B1 exam?
If a prospect fails, they need to pay the complete examination charge once again to retake it. There are generally no marked down "re-sit" rates. This is why thorough preparation is necessary to avoid doubling the expense.
3. For how long is the B1 certificate legitimate?
For UK migration functions, a SELT certificate is generally legitimate for two years from the date of the examination. Nevertheless, if the certificate has actually been used in an effective migration application in the past, the Home Office may still accept it for settlement or citizenship even after the two-year period has passed.
4. Can the test be taken online from home?
No. To please the "Secure" part of the Secure English Language Test, prospects need to participate in a physical, government-approved test center where their identity can be validated by means of passport or biometric residence permit (BRP).
5. Can a higher-level examination be taken instead?
Yes. If an applicant has currently passed a B2, C1, or C2 level examination (which are greater than B1 Bescheinigung), these are accepted by the Home Office as long as they were taken at an authorized SELT center and cover both speaking and listening.
